Real Christmas Trees

Pros

    Authenticity: Absolutely nothing beats the smell of fresh pine in your home throughout the holidays. Environmentally Friendly: Genuine trees are biodegradable and can be recycled after use. Support Regional Farmers: Purchasing a genuine tree supports regional services and farmers. Customizable: You can pick the best size, shape, and kind of tree for your home.

Cons

    Maintenance: Genuine trees require watering and clean-up of fallen needles. Short Lifespan: They might only last for a couple of weeks before drying out. Allergies: Some individuals might dislike pine sap or pollen. Cost: Genuine trees can be more costly than artificial ones in the long run.

Artificial Christmas Trees

Pros

    Convenience: No requirement to water or tidy up needles, simply set it up and decorate. Longevity: Artificial trees can last for several years with proper care. Hypoallergenic: Ideal for those with allergies to natural trees. Cost-Effective: While initial investment might be higher, they save cash over time.

Cons

    Less Authentic: Artificial trees lack the natural scent and feel of genuine trees. Environmental Impact: Many synthetic trees are made from non-biodegradable materials. Storage Space: They can use up a great deal of storage area when not in use. Limited Customization: You are restricted to the size and design of tree you purchase.

FAQs

Are real Christmas trees more eco-friendly than artificial ones?
    While genuine trees are eco-friendly and assistance regional farmers, artificial trees can be recycled for several years, reducing general waste.
Can I still get that fresh pine aroma with a synthetic tree?
    Yes! Numerous stores sell aromatic ornaments or sprays that mimic the odor of a genuine tree.
How often do I need to water a real Christmas tree?
    It is recommended to water a genuine tree daily to avoid it from drying too quickly.
Are there any fire security worry about either type of tree?
    Both genuine and artificial trees present fire threats if not correctly maintained. Make sure to keep them far from heat sources and examine lights for torn wires.
Can I recycle my real Christmas tree after the holidays?
    Many cities offer recycling programs for real trees, which can be become mulch or compost.
What is the average lifespan of a synthetic Christmas tree?
    With proper care, a synthetic tree can last anywhere from 5 to 10 years or more, depending upon quality.
